首页 » 排名链接 » JavaScript上下滚动技术,打造沉浸式网页体验的关键

JavaScript上下滚动技术,打造沉浸式网页体验的关键

admin 2024-11-25 17:46:09 0

扫一扫用手机浏览

文章目录 [+]

随着互联网技术的飞速发展,网页设计逐渐成为一门融合美学与技术的艺术。在众多网页设计元素中,JavaScript上下滚动技术以其独特的魅力,为用户带来沉浸式的浏览体验。本文将深入探讨JavaScript上下滚动技术的原理、应用及优化策略,旨在帮助设计师和开发者更好地运用这一技术,提升网页的视觉效果。

一、JavaScript上下滚动技术原理

JavaScript上下滚动技术,顾名思义,是指通过JavaScript代码控制网页内容的上下滚动。其主要原理如下:

JavaScript上下滚动技术,打造沉浸式网页体验的关键 排名链接
(图片来自网络侵删)

1. 监听鼠标滚轮或键盘事件:当用户滚动鼠标滚轮或按下键盘上的上下键时,触发滚动事件。

2. 计算滚动距离:根据滚动事件,计算出滚动距离。

3. 更新页面将计算出的滚动距离应用到页面元素上,实现上下滚动效果。

4. 动画效果:为了使滚动更加平滑,可以添加CSS动画效果。

二、JavaScript上下滚动技术应用

1. 内容展示:通过上下滚动,可以展示大量内容,如文章、图片、视频等,提高页面信息密度。

2. 导航栏设计:在导航栏中添加上下滚动按钮,方便用户快速定位到页面特定位置。

3. 网页游戏:在网页游戏中,上下滚动可以控制角色移动,提高游戏体验。

4. 轮播图:通过JavaScript上下滚动技术,可以实现轮播图功能,展示多张图片。

三、JavaScript上下滚动技术优化策略

1. 减少重绘和回流:在编写JavaScript代码时,尽量避免触发重绘和回流,以提高页面性能。

2. 使用requestAnimationFrame:requestAnimationFrame可以保证在合适的时机进行DOM操作,提高页面流畅度。

3. 使用CSS3动画:CSS3动画相较于JavaScript动画,具有更好的性能表现。

4. 减少事件监听器数量:合理使用事件委托,减少事件监听器数量,降低内存消耗。

5. 响应式设计:针对不同设备和屏幕尺寸,进行适配优化,提高用户体验。

JavaScript上下滚动技术是网页设计中的一项重要技能,它能够为用户带来沉浸式的浏览体验。通过深入了解其原理和应用,我们可以更好地运用这一技术,提升网页的视觉效果。关注性能优化,使页面运行更加流畅,为用户带来更好的使用体验。

参考文献:

[1] 张三,李四. JavaScript上下滚动技术原理及实践[J]. 网页设计与应用,2018,2(4):10-15.

[2] 王五,赵六. 基于JavaScript的上下滚动技术在网页设计中的应用[J]. 网页设计与应用,2019,3(2):20-24.

[3] 陈七,刘八. JavaScript动画性能优化策略研究[J]. 网页设计与应用,2020,4(1):30-34.

相关文章

芯片,IT时代的核心驱动力

在信息技术的迅猛发展过程中,芯片作为IT产业的核心驱动力,扮演着举足轻重的角色。从最初的半导体器件到如今的智能芯片,芯片技术不断突...

排名链接 2024-12-27 阅读0 评论0

银行IT龙头,引领金融科技浪潮的先锋力量

随着金融科技的飞速发展,银行IT领域成为了金融行业竞争的焦点。在众多银行IT企业中,有一家被誉为“银行IT龙头”的企业,以其卓越的...

排名链接 2024-12-27 阅读0 评论0

corr语言,引领未来编程潮流的强大工具

随着科技的飞速发展,编程语言在计算机科学领域扮演着越来越重要的角色。在众多编程语言中,corr语言以其独特的优势,逐渐成为未来编程...

排名链接 2024-12-27 阅读0 评论0